Overnight, You Have Peace of Mind

Your caregiver sleeps in a private space within the home and is available if you need assistance. While they're not providing active care around the clock (that's 24/7 care), their presence provides reassurance and support when needed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Live-in care means one dedicated caregiver resides in the home and provides extended daily support with appropriate rest periods. They sleep overnight and are available if needed, but are not actively awake and providing care around the clock. If you need someone awake overnight or continuous supervision from multiple caregivers, that falls under 24/7 Care.

Live-in availability varies by state due to labor and housing regulations. We’ll help confirm what’s possible in your area.
